Output e4cdcae8eae2daf71c23e7b0f4817ddd59c249df10ee252abbcee3146bd96d61:1

value
106980285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ab57fbeecfce1481e9f6502debe6a5b92f08e05 OP_EQUAL
address
39xeAadLKqdoJxRDg6KDJLV71Ly3KRvi3N
transaction
e4cdcae8eae2daf71c23e7b0f4817ddd59c249df10ee252abbcee3146bd96d61
confirmations
321058
spent
true